Output 56c76212b60f65d5cd59a932144761243b3e8556d58f28d4d3e70e0347ead161:21

value
18863839
script pubkey
OP_0 OP_PUSHBYTES_20 daca6ee8017a7c589e5cee2c41650df1138460ec
address
ltc1qmt9xa6qp0f7938juackyzegd7yfcgc8v86s4tm
transaction
56c76212b60f65d5cd59a932144761243b3e8556d58f28d4d3e70e0347ead161
spent
true